/*Estilos personales*/

body{

}

#contnav {
    width: 100%;
}

#imglogo{
    /*width: 300px;*/
 width: auto;
  height: 140px;
}

#infoHead{
  text-align: left;
  font-size: 15px;
}

.headPrincipal{
  width: 90%;
  /*margin:;*/
}

#header{
 border-bottom: 5px solid #01673f;
 line-height: 28px;
}

#imgsliderlogo{
    width: 50%;
    /*margin-left: 150px;*/
    float: right;
}

#imgslidereste{
    width: 50%;
    margin-left: 100px;
}

#main-slider .carousel .slidenegro h1 {
  color: #000;
  font-size: 36px;
}

#main-slider .carousel .slidenegro h2 {
  color: #000;
  font-size: 36px;
}

/*.slidenegro{
   color:#000;
}*/

#pidehora {
  
  padding-bottom: 5px;

}

.imgesp {
  
  float: right;
/*  margin: 0px 0px 15px 15px;*/
width: 600px;
min-height: auto;

}

.imgespv {
  
  float: right;
/*  margin: 0px 0px 15px 15px;*/
height: 500px;
min-width: : auto;

}
.imgespc {
  
  float: right;
/*  margin: 0px 0px 15px 15px;*/
height: 350px;
min-width: : auto;

}
/*#colormenu{
  
  background-color: #e5f9e1;

}
*/
.homepage{
  
  background-color: #e5f9e1;

}

#txtConvenio{
  color: #fff;
}

.tituloNosotros h2{
  font-size: 36px;
  margin-top: 0;
  margin-bottom: 20px;
}

.tituloNosotros {
  text-align: center;
/*  padding-bottom: 55px;*/
   /*border-bottom: 5px solid #01673f;*/
}